What are APIs?

Before we dive into the list, let's quickly cover what APIs are. APIs, or Application Programming Interfaces, are sets of defined rules that enable different applications, services, or systems to communicate with each other. They allow you to access data, services, or functionality from other providers, which you can then use to build your own applications.

Top 10 Free APIs

Here are the top 10 free APIs that you can use to build profitable side projects:

  1. OpenWeatherMap API: This API provides current and forecasted weather data for locations all over the world. You can use it to build a weather app, a website that displays the current weather, or even a service that sends weather updates to users via SMS or email.
  2. Google Maps API: This API provides access to Google Maps' functionality, including geocoding, directions, and street view. You can use it to build a mapping application, a logistics platform, or even a real estate website.
  3. Unsplash API: This API provides access to a vast library of high-resolution photos. You can use it to build a photo gallery app, a website that displays random photos, or even a service that generates photo-based content.
  4. CoinGecko API: This API provides current and historical data on cryptocurrency prices. You can use it to build a cryptocurrency tracker, a portfolio manager, or even a trading bot.
  5. TMDb API: This API provides access to a vast library of movie and TV show data, including posters, trailers, and ratings. You can use it to build a movie streaming app, a website that displays movie reviews, or even a service that recommends movies based on user preferences.
  6. NewsAPI: This API provides access to a vast library of news articles from around the world. You can use it to build a news aggregator app, a website that displays news headlines, or even a service that generates news-based content.
  7. Spotify Web API: This API provides access to Spotify's music library, including song metadata, artist data, and playlist functionality. You can use it to build a music streaming app, a website that displays music recommendations, or even a service that generates playlists based on user preferences.
  8. GitHub API: This API provides access to GitHub's repository data, including code, issues, and pull requests. You can use it to build a project management tool, a website that displays GitHub data, or even a service that automates GitHub tasks.
  9. Twitter API: This API provides access to Twitter's data, including tweets, users, and trends. You can use it to build a social media monitoring tool, a website that displays Twitter data, or even a service that automates Twitter tasks.
  10. YouTube Data API: This API provides access to YouTube's video data, including titles, descriptions, and views. You can use it to build a video streaming app, a website that displays YouTube videos, or even a service that generates video-based content.
